Q.

Two capillary tubes of the same length l and radii r and 2r are fitted to the bottom of a vessel with pressure head p in parallel with each other. What should be the radius of the single tube of the same length l that can replace the two so that the rate of flow is not affected?

Detailed Solution

Radius R of the single tube is given by 

1REFF=1R1+1R2

         πρR48ηl=πρr48ηl+πρ2r48ηl

or    R4=r4+16r4 or R=171/4 r which is choice (1).
